Summary
Sewer rates for multipurpose buildings. For purposes of thestatute governing sanitation districts in certain municipalities, providesthat in establishing sewer fees, a district must provide for: (1) the apportionment or proration of fees assessed with respect to a multipurpose building in a manner that recognizes the different purposes to which the multipurpose building is put; or (2) the application of different fee schedules or classifications of fees to the individual units or parts of a multipurpose building in a manner that recognizes the primary purpose of the individual units or parts.
